Explanation: Continental crust is a thick plate that comprises of sedimentary, metamorphic and igneous types of rocks. They are less denser compared to the oceanic crust and usually have a thickness of about 35-40 km, and increases upto 75-80 km at the mountain ranges. It often contains silicate minerals, that are mainly enriched in sodium, aluminium, calcium and potassium.
